Eligibility
Inclusion criteria
Inclusion criteria: Inclusion criteria: Participants from the general population having knowledge of English and aged between 18 and 30 years. COVID-19 group: History of COVID-19 infection confirmed by RT-PCR or antigens test at least 1 year prior to the study will be included. The control group will consist of age-matched individuals who did not have any signs or symptoms of COVID-19 and were not infected by COVID-19.
Exclusion criteria
Exclusion criteria: Active COVID-19 symptoms, autonomic imbalance, cardiovascular diseases, previously diagnosed neuropsychological disorders, or a history of severe COVID-related hospitalization
Design outcomes
Primary
| Measure | Time frame |
|---|---|
| Extracellular water (ECW) and total body weight (TBW) will be measured using differential impedance at 50 kHz and 200 kHz, respectively. Subsequently, intracellular water (ICW) will be obtained by deduction of ECW from TBW. Body fat (in kg) and lean body mass (in kg): These parameters will also be expressed as percentages body fat % and lean %. Fat-Free Mass Index (FFMI) Body Fat Mass Index (BFMI) will be derived from manufacturer-programmed predictive equations. In the analysis, hydration fractions obtained from regression equations will be used to calculate lean body mass (LBW) from total body weight (TBW). Fat mass will then be determined by the difference between TBW and LBW.Timepoint: one year from 01-10-2024 to 01-10-2025 | — |
